Here's the part most guides bury: grind uniformity controls extraction more than your brewer, your water temperature, or your technique. According to the Specialty Coffee Association's brewing standards, extraction happens when water dissolves soluble compounds from coffee particles, and uneven particle sizes mean uneven extraction. Some grounds give up their flavor too fast. Others barely release anything. You taste both in the same sip.

A blade grinder produces a chaotic mix of powder and chunks. A burr grinder produces particles in a narrow size range. That single difference reshapes bitterness, sweetness, body, and aroma.

Blade vs Burr Grinder for Home Coffee: The Core Differences

A blade grinder chops coffee with a spinning metal propeller, while a burr grinder crushes beans between two abrasive surfaces set a fixed distance apart (Moccamaster USA | Moccamaster KM5 Burr Grinder). That mechanical difference determines everything downstream: particle size distribution, heat friction, and how repeatable your results are.

How Blade Grinders Chop and Why It Matters

Blade grinders work like a blender. Beans bounce around a chamber while a blade slices whatever it catches. The result is a wide spread of particle sizes, from fine dust to coarse boulders, all in one batch. You also can't control the outcome precisely. Two pulses of the same duration rarely produce the same grind.

Heat is the second problem. The blade spins fast and generates friction, and that heat can start degrading delicate aromatics before you ever brew. For drip coffee with a forgiving brewer, a blade grinder can get you a drinkable cup. For pour over or espresso, it's a losing battle.

How Burr Grinders Crush for Uniformity

Burr grinders feed beans between two burrs and crush them to a set gap width. Because the gap is fixed, every particle exits at roughly the same size. You get uniformity, repeatability, and a grind setting you can return to tomorrow.

The practical payoff is dialing in. When you change one variable, grind size, you can taste the difference and adjust with confidence. With a blade grinder, you're changing several variables at once every time you press the button.

How Grind Size Affects Coffee Extraction

Grind size determines how fast water pulls flavor from coffee grounds. Smaller particles have more surface area and extract faster; larger particles extract slower. If your grind is too fine, water over-extracts and you get bitterness and a drying, astringent finish (Effect of grinding, extraction time and type of coffee on the physicochemical and flavour...). Too coarse, and water under-extracts, leaving a sour, thin, hollow cup. This is the single most useful lever you own as a home brewer, because changing the grind changes extraction rate, flavor profile, and body without touching your recipe, your water, or your technique.

The mechanism is worth understanding because it explains why grind beats almost every other variable. Extraction is a diffusion process: hot water dissolves soluble compounds, acids, sugars, lipids, and bitter alkaloids, off the surface of each particle and then out of its interior. A fine particle exposes more surface area per gram, so the fast-releasing compounds (fruit acids and sugars) come off quickly and the slower, heavier compounds (bitterness and astringency) follow soon after. A coarse particle releases the same compounds, just more slowly. Your brew time and water temperature set the window; your grind size decides whether the coffee finishes extracting inside that window or gets cut off partway.

Fines, Boulders, and the Flavor They Create

Fines are the powdery particles that slip through a grinder and extract almost instantly, contributing bitterness and astringency. Boulders are oversized chunks that barely extract at all, leaving sourness and a hollow finish. A good burr grinder minimizes both. A blade grinder produces both in every batch, which is why the same beans can taste harsh and weak at the same time, you are literally tasting over-extracted fines and under-extracted boulders in the same sip.

Particle size distribution, not average particle size, is what separates a good grinder from a great one. Two grinders can both target a medium setting and still produce very different cups if one throws a wide spread of fines and boulders and the other keeps 80 percent of particles inside a narrow band. This is why burr geometry, burr size, and burr sharpness matter as much as the number on the dial.

Dialing In by Brew Method: Drip, French Press, Pour Over

Each brewing method wants a different grind, and a burr grinder lets you hit it repeatably. Use this as a starting point, then adjust by taste:

Brew Method Starting Grind Adjust If... Typical Steep/Brew Time
Drip coffee Medium Bitter → coarser; sour → finer 4-5 minutes
French press Coarse Sludgy → coarser; weak → finer 4 minutes
Pour over Medium-fine Slow drain → coarser; fast → finer 2.5-3.5 minutes
Espresso Fine Gushing → finer; choking → coarser 25-30 seconds

A few method-specific notes that most guides skip:

  • French press is the most forgiving method because full immersion and a metal mesh filter tolerate a wider particle spread. That is also why it hides a mediocre grinder better than any other method, if you only brew French press, a burr grinder is a smaller upgrade than the marketing suggests.
  • Pour over is the least forgiving. A cone brewer with a paper filter punishes fines with a stalled, bitter drawdown and punishes boulders with a fast, sour cup. This is where a burr grinder earns its price fastest.
  • Drip sits in the middle. A flat-bed basket and a paper filter smooth out moderate inconsistency, so a mid-range burr grinder is usually enough.
  • Espresso demands the tightest distribution and the finest adjustment. Stepped grinders often cannot move in small enough increments, which is why espresso drinkers gravitate toward stepless adjustment.
Pro Tip Change one notch at a time and brew the same recipe twice before judging. Grind adjustments often need a second cup to reveal the real difference, and your palate needs a baseline to compare against.

Reading the Cup: A Troubleshooting Shortcut

When a cup misses, the flavor tells you which direction to move:

  • Sour, sharp, salty, or thin → under-extracted → grind finer or extend brew time.
  • Bitter, dry, ashy, or hollow → over-extracted → grind coarser or shorten brew time.
  • Both sour and bitter in the same cup → uneven particle distribution → the grinder, not the recipe, is the problem.
  • Good flavor but weak body → likely a ratio or dose issue, not grind.

That third line is the one that answers the keyword question directly. When a cup tastes simultaneously sour and bitter, no recipe tweak fixes it, because the problem is the spread of particle sizes. A burr grinder is the fix. A blade grinder cannot be dialed out of that failure mode.

Conical vs Flat Burrs: Which Geometry Suits Your Brew

Conical burrs use a cone-shaped inner burr spinning inside a ring burr, while flat burrs use two parallel discs facing each other. Both crush beans uniformly, but they produce slightly different particle distributions and carry different price and maintenance profiles.

Conical burrs are the common choice for home brewing. They're quieter, more forgiving of imperfect alignment, and typically cheaper to manufacture. Flat burrs, common in commercial settings, tend to produce a narrower particle distribution that some brewers prefer for clarity in pour over and espresso. The tradeoff is cost, noise, and a steeper alignment requirement.

For most home setups, a quality conical burr grinder delivers everything you need. Flat burrs matter more when you're chasing the last few percent of cup clarity and you're willing to pay for it.

What Most Reviews Skip: Noise, Retention, and Repairability

Spec sheets rarely mention the three things that shape daily ownership: how loud the grinder is, how much coffee it wastes, and whether you can fix it when something wears out. These are the details that decide whether a grinder feels like a tool or a chore, and they are the ones most reviews skip entirely. Here is how to evaluate each before you buy.

Noise Levels in a Small Kitchen

Burr grinders run quieter than blade grinders because they spin slower and crush rather than chop. In a small kitchen, that difference matters at 6 a.m. A blade grinder's high-pitched whine carries through walls and wakes up the household. A burr grinder produces a lower, shorter sound, and hand grinders are nearly silent, which is why they appeal to early risers and apartment dwellers.

The practical range to expect: a typical electric burr grinder runs in the range of a normal conversation to a blender, while a blade grinder sits closer to a blender at full speed. Hand grinders produce only the sound of beans cracking, which is roughly the volume of rustling paper. If noise is your deciding factor, a hand grinder solves it completely, at the cost of 30 to 60 seconds of cranking per dose and a practical limit on how fine you can grind for espresso.

A few noise-reduction tactics that actually work:

  • Grind before bed, not at 6 a.m. Ground coffee stales faster than whole beans, but a sealed container in a cool cabinet buys you several hours with minimal loss.
  • Set the grinder on a rubber mat or folded towel. Vibration transfer to the countertop is a large share of perceived noise.
  • Choose a slower-RPM model. Lower burr speed means less motor whine and less heat, though it also means longer grind times.

Retention, Static, and Waste

Retention is the coffee that stays inside the grinder after you finish grinding. Every gram retained is a gram that goes stale in the chute and ends up in your next cup. Static makes it worse, clinging fines to the burr chamber and exit chute.

Retention matters most for two reasons. First, stale grounds contaminate the next dose, if you retain a gram and dose 18 grams, roughly 5 percent of your next cup is yesterday's coffee. Second, retention is a hidden cost. A grinder that retains a gram per dose wastes a gram per dose, which adds up across hundreds of mornings.

Lower retention means fresher coffee and less waste. Single-dose grinders, which you fill with exactly the beans you need, keep retention minimal. If you grind a large hopper at once, expect more stale grounds to accumulate over time. Anti-static coatings, bellows-style purge mechanisms, and vertical or near-vertical chute designs all reduce retention. If a manufacturer publishes a retention figure, treat it as a best-case number measured with a clean grinder; real-world retention is usually higher.

Spare Parts and Long-Term Durability

A burr grinder is a repairable machine, and that changes the math on the "worth it" question. Burrs wear out and can be replaced. Motors, switches, and hoppers are often available as parts. A blade grinder is typically disposable; when the motor dies, you replace the whole unit.

Before buying, check three things:

  1. Does the manufacturer sell replacement burrs? If not, the grinder has a fixed lifespan.
  2. How are the burrs removed? Tool-free or single-tool designs are far easier to service than models requiring disassembly of the entire housing.
  3. Is the burr set rated for a lifespan? Manufacturers that publish a burr-life rating are signaling that replacement is part of the design, not an afterthought.

A grinder you can service can last years, which spreads the cost across hundreds of mornings. That is the real answer to whether a burr grinder is worth it: the upfront price is not the price. The price is the upfront cost minus the resale or service life, divided by the number of cups it produces. A repairable grinder with replaceable burrs wins that math against a disposable blade grinder almost every time, provided you actually replace the burrs when they dull.

Best Entry Level Burr Grinders for Specialty Coffee

Entry-level burr grinders have improved dramatically, and you no longer need to spend a fortune to get uniform grinds. The best entry level burr grinders for specialty coffee share three traits: adjustable burrs, low retention, and parts you can replace.

When you're evaluating options, weigh these factors:

  • Burr type and size: Larger burrs grind faster and more consistently, but cost more.
  • Adjustment mechanism: Stepped grinders click into set positions; stepless grinders offer infinite adjustment for espresso.
  • Motor torque: Higher torque handles light roasts without stalling.
  • Retention and static control: Look for anti-static coatings or single-dose designs.
  • Repairability: Confirm replacement burrs are sold separately.

Is a Burr Grinder Worth It for Your Home Brewing Setup?

A burr grinder is worth it if you drink coffee regularly, brew with any method that rewards consistency, and want repeatable results. The upgrade pays off fastest for pour over, French press, and espresso drinkers, where uneven grinds are most obvious in the cup.

Skip it if you only drink pre-ground coffee, brew occasionally, or genuinely can't taste the difference and don't want to. There's no shame in that. But if you've ever had a cup that tasted flat and bitter at the same time, uneven grind is the likely culprit.

Here's the honest math. You'll spend more upfront on a burr grinder than on a blade grinder. In return, you get years of service, replaceable parts, and control over one of the two variables that matter most in brewing. The beans are the other one.

Frequently Asked Questions

What is the main difference between a blade and a burr grinder?

A blade grinder uses a spinning metal blade to chop beans into random sizes, creating a mix of fine dust and coarse chunks. A burr grinder passes beans between two abrasive surfaces set at a fixed distance, producing a uniform grind. That consistency is why a burr grinder is worth it for home brewing: even extraction depends on all particles releasing flavor at the same rate. Blade grinders are cheaper, but the uneven result often leaves your cup both bitter and sour at once.

Does a burr grinder really make coffee taste better?

Yes, because grind consistency controls extraction. When particles are uniform, water extracts flavor evenly, giving you a balanced cup with clear sweetness and acidity. A blade grinder produces fines that over-extract and boulders that under-extract, so you taste both bitterness and sourness. For drip coffee, French press, or pour over, the improvement from a burr grinder is one of the most noticeable upgrades you can make. The difference is especially clear with light-roasted single origins like a Kenya or Tanzania.

How does grind consistency affect coffee extraction?

Grind consistency determines how evenly water can pull flavor from coffee grounds. Uniform particles expose similar surface area, so extraction happens at one rate. If you have a mix of fine and coarse particles, the fines over-extract and release bitter compounds while the boulders under-extract and leave sour, weak notes. The result is a cup that tastes muddy or hollow. A burr grinder solves this by producing a narrow particle size distribution, which is why it matters for any brewing method.

Is a manual burr grinder worth the effort for home brewing?

For small doses, yes. Manual burr grinders cost less than electric models and often use the same conical burr design, so they deliver consistent grinds for drip, pour over, or French press. The trade-off is time and effort: grinding 30 grams for a full pot can take a few minutes of cranking. If you brew multiple cups daily or want espresso-level fineness, an electric burr grinder is more practical. For one or two cups, a manual burr grinder is a solid entry point.

Do I need a burr grinder for a French press or drip coffee maker?

You do not strictly need one, but a burr grinder makes a bigger difference than most people expect. French press relies on a coarse, even grind to avoid sludge and over-extraction. Drip coffee makers perform best with a medium grind that allows steady water flow. A blade grinder's inconsistent particles will clog filters or slip through the mesh, leading to bitter or weak coffee. If you already own a drip machine or French press, a burr grinder is worth it for the flavor upgrade alone.
